Effectiveness of conceptual change text-oriented instruction on students' understanding of cellular respiration concepts
Cakir, Os; Geban, Ömer; Yuruk, N (Wiley, 2002-07-01)
This study investigated the effect of conceptual change text-oriented instruction over traditional instruction on students' understanding of cellular respiration concepts and their attitudes toward biology as a school subject. The sample of this study consisted of 84 eleventh-grade students from four classes of a high school. Effectiveness of Argument-Based Inquiry Approach on Grade 8 Students' Science Content Achievement, Metacognition, and Epistemological Beliefs
Deprem, Sabahat Tugce Tucel; Çakıroğlu, Jale; Öztekin, Ceren; KINGIR, SEVGİ (2022-07-01)
The quasi-experimental, two-group (treatment and comparison), pretest-posttest study of metacognition, epistemological beliefs, and science content achievement explored the effectiveness of argument-based inquiry (ABI) instruction as opposed to traditional teacher-directed lectures and structured activities. Participants included 60 eight-grade students attending two intact classes of a middle school located in an urban area.
